Output 5103fbafb3744f2f0af4fc77d5acde47aed89f48e24875027c321aa0d59f752e:0

value
17700217
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 babc3aa4daf4e753a7d7b66afd10dfa329a4d7b7 OP_EQUALVERIFY OP_CHECKSIG
address
1J2NB4qHJw9Z6GDLfaGhFDFDYnxKn1FaLJ
transaction
5103fbafb3744f2f0af4fc77d5acde47aed89f48e24875027c321aa0d59f752e
spent
true